Kim Jong Il Inspects Young Cadres Training Sub-Unit of KPA

Korean Central News Agency of DPRK via Korea News Service (KNS)

   Pyongyang, June 3 (KCNA) -- Supreme Commander of the Korean People's Army Kim Jong Il, general secretary of the Workers' Party of Korea and chairman of the National Defence Commission of the DPRK, inspected the young cadres training sub-unit of KPA Large Combined Unit 324. After being saluted, he learned in detail about how the education is conducted there.
    He expressed great satisfaction over the fact that the sub-unit is conducting effective education by sufficiently securing educational equipment and materials for study to help the trainees acquire versatile knowledge and improve their cultural attainment.
    Then he went round a bedroom, a mess hall, a wash-cum-bath house, a non-stable food store, a barn and other supply service facilities. He highly appreciated the achievements made by the sub-unit in the last period, noting that it has done a lot not only in the education aimed at training an increasing number of able young cadres but in the overall work including its management.
    After making the round of the sub-unit, he set forth important tasks, which would serve as guidelines in training young cadres.
    Future hinges on how to prepare the young people as most vital pillars of society and on how to enhance their role, he said, adding that the work with youth is particularly important for the KPA made up of young people.
    Pointing out that in order to prepare all trainees as able young cadres it is necessary to steadily improve the contents of education and the qualifications of the teachers, he specified the orientation and ways to do so.
    If the politico-ideological education is to be conducted in a unique manner to suit the characteristic features of the young soldiers, it is very important to raise the political and cultural levels of the young cadres and improve their organizing and guiding ability and, at the same time, help them acquire qualifications as standard-bearers of the ranks possessed of great agitating power and elocution, in particular, he noted, calling for directing great efforts to this work.
    He had a photograph taken with servicepersons and trainees of the sub-unit.
    He was accompanied by Ri Yong Chol, member of the Central Military Commission of the WPK and first vice department director of the C.C., WPK, and Hwang Pyong So, vice department director of the C.C., WPK.
